A semi-infinite programming problem is an optimization problem in which finitely many variables appear in infinitely many constraints. This model naturally arises in an abundant number of applications in different fields of mathematics, economics and engineering. In this paper, an unconstrained convex programming dual approach for solving a class of linear semi-infinite programming problems is proposed. Both primal and dual convergence results are established under some basic assumptions. Numerical examples are also included to illustrate this approach.

This work presents a stochastic outer approximation algorithm to solve air pollution control problem while minimizing the control costs which thereby occur. These air quality standards give rise to an infinite number of constraints and this is a semi-infinite programming problem.
